3 Reycruit Consulting Jobs
Big Data engineer - Python/Scala (8-17 yrs)
Reycruit Consulting
posted 7d ago
Flexible timing
Key skills for the job
Responsibilities include :
- Hands-on experience designing & managing large data models, writing performant SQL queries, and working with large datasets and related technologies.
- Work closely with the Architecture group in delivering technical solutions.
- Experience with designing and building large-scale data processing systems.
- Experience in analyzing data to identify deliverables, gaps, and inconsistencies in data sets.
- Participate in the testing of prototypes & validate test procedures to ensure that they apply to the design.
- Perform root-cause analysis (RCA) of complex issues ranging from hardware, operating system, application, network, and information security platforms while working closely with various infrastructure teams and business users to quickly arrive at creative, tactical, and long-term solutions.
- Excellent verbal and written communication skills, especially in technical communications
- Collaborate with project teams (solution architects, business, QA, and project management) to ensure solutions meet business objectives and fall within timelines and acceptance criteria.
- Experience monitoring, troubleshooting, and tuning services and applications and operational expertise such as good troubleshooting skills, understanding of systems capacity, bottlenecks, and basics of memory, CPU, OS, storage, and networks.
Expected Technical Skills :
- 8+ years' experience as a software engineer or equivalent designing large data-heavy distributed systems and/or high-traffic web apps.
- Must have 4+ experience using big data tools such as Spark / PySpark)
- Must have experience in Airflow pipeline orchestration.
- At least 4 years of hands-on implementation experience working with a combination of the following technologies : PySpark, Spark, Python, EMR, Airflow, and KAFKA.
- Strong experience in two of the following SQL and NoSQL Databases
- Demonstrate substantial depth of knowledge and experience in Python, Data Streaming, Big Data, Flink, Spark, Scala, Python, Kubernetes, and wrangling of various data formats like Parquet and JSON.
- Hands-on experience with Linux and administration.
Functional Areas: Software/Testing/Networking
Read full job description